jQuery如何获取文字的宽度?方法介绍
程序员文章站
2022-04-03 17:12:54
...
jQuery如何获取文字的宽度?下面本篇文章给大家介绍一下使用jq获取文字宽度的方法。有一定的参考价值,有需要的朋友可以参考一下,希望对大家有所帮助。
相关推荐:《jq视频》
获取字符串的长度很简单,但是如何获取一个字符串的字体宽度却是一个不太好操作的问题,今天查阅了许多资料,终于找到了解决方法:
1.首先,需要添加一个标签,HTML代码如下:
<body> <span></span> </body>
2.接下来直接在String的原型中添加获取文字宽度的函数,在js代码中加入以下代码即可:
String.prototype.visualLength = function() { let ruler = $("span"); ruler.text(this); return ruler[0].offsetWidth; };
3.使用js来调用这个方法:
let text = "分"; let len = text.visualLength(); console.log(len);
效果如下:
记得要引入jq,博主使用的是es6
更多编程相关知识,请访问:编程入门!!
以上就是jQuery如何获取文字的宽度?方法介绍的详细内容,更多请关注其它相关文章!
下一篇: 一起聊聊php中的传统三层架构
推荐阅读
-
如何快速解决jQuery与其他库冲突的方法介绍
-
如何启动ghost 获取以及启动Ghost的多种方法介绍
-
手机录音如何转换成文字?录音啦把手机录音转换成文字的方法介绍
-
jquery获取div的高度和宽度(获取div实际宽高度的方法)
-
jquery获取div的高度和宽度(获取div实际宽高度的方法)
-
notefirst如何获取文献全文?notefirst获取文献全文的方法介绍
-
语音如何转换成文字?闪电文字语音转换软件将语音转换成文字的方法介绍
-
IObit Software Updater如何激活?获取iobit software updater pro授权的方法介绍
-
如何启动ghost 获取以及启动Ghost的多种方法介绍
-
手机录音如何转换成文字?录音啦把手机录音转换成文字的方法介绍